Role Summary
As an Email & SMS Account Manager, you’ll own retention strategy and execution across 8–10 eCommerce accounts. You will lead client communication, craft on-brand campaign concepts, oversee QA, and translate performance metrics into actionable insights. The role blends strategy and hands-on work—building advanced flows, optimizing segmentation and testing, and guiding designers and copywriters to deliver conversion-focused creative. This is a full-time, remote position with EST hours.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ead client communication and retention strategy across a multi-account portfolio.
- Develop campaign concepts aligned to brand voice, goals, and customer journey stages.
- Build and optimize advanced email/SMS flows, calendars, segmentation, and A/B tests.
- Collaborate with designers and copywriters to deliver error-free, conversion-driven assets.
- Conduct ongoing audits to surface automation, segmentation, and testing opportunities.
- Translate CTR, CVR, RPR, and LTV into clear insights and recommendations for clients.
- Manage timelines and resources to meet deadlines without compromising quality or brand integrity.
- Ensure rigorous QA and cohesive brand alignment across email and SMS touchpoints.
- Stay current on retention trends and propose innovative, testable ideas to drive performance.
Ideal Profile (Required)
- 1+ years in eCommerce retention (email/SMS) with demonstrated strategy ownership.
- Ability to manage 8–10 client accounts and guide a small creative team with minimal oversight.
- Advanced experience with Klaviyo or comparable ESPs; strong campaign portfolio end-to-end.
- Strategic thinker with creative problem-solving and performance focus.
- Confident communicator who simplifies complex data and plans for stakeholders.
- Meticulous QA mindset—no typos, broken links, or off-brand creative.
- Comfort operating in a fast-paced agency with high ownership and low micromanagement.
- Fluency in core eCommerce metrics (CAC, LTV, CVR, RPR) and retention levers.
- U.S. or Colombia-based; within ±3 hours of EST; available Monday–Friday, 9 a.m.–6 p.m. EST.
Nice To Haves
- Experience with Postscript, Attentive, or other SMS platforms.
- Familiarity with Notion, Slack, and project management tools.
